What won't we try in our quest for perfect health, beauty, and the fountain of youth? Well, just imagine a time when doctors prescribed morphine for crying infants. When liquefied gold was touted as immortality in a glass. And when strychnine - yes, that strychnine, the one used in rat poison - was dosed like Viagra. Looking back with fascination, horror, and not a little dash of dark, knowing humor, Quackery recounts the lively, at times unbelievable, history of medical misfires and malpractices.

This is real
Revisado: 08-17-23
As a former teacher, I am listening and laughing at the absurdity of the different events and challenges teacher face. Some, non teachers, will say these can’t be real. But I can assure you, they are well with in the realm of possibility. When I taught middle school. These was a school map in the teachers lounge with pens stuck around. This was to indicate to teachers where to look if/when they passed by because these were hot spot for sexual activity. I have been asked/told to change grades so students would pass. I do want you to realize that in the part of the book where she is talking about essay questions in the PARC test, she could not only loose her job but also be prosecuted for divulging any details about a test either current or past. We are strictly forbidden to discuss any question we see on the tests with students, other teachers, or even a friend. Sample tests are made and those and only those questions can be referred to when “practicing” for the test. Also, practicing for the test begins about 6 weeks prior to the test. Drills, practice, drills, and more ABCD practice. A teachers value is based on the one day a student takes the test. Teachers are very limited on what they can say to students during the test, so when we see Bob and Angie marking randomly because they don’t care, and there no consequences for the student, all we can say “slow down and take your time.” That’s it. And if we get rehired, but on a support plan, pay, and promotional opportunities depend on these tests. It’s is crazy and is the reality of the teacher who makes enough to stay right above the poverty line, gets little to no support for administration and parents, is bullied and threatened. Post-CoVid has brought us into the reality of a major teacher shortage nation wide. Schools were pressured to open so that the nation had a place to drop their children. Teachers were not considered important enough to say “no” in order to protect them. They are not nurses or doctors and forced to be in a classroom with 30+ coughing, sneezing, nose picking kids and told Lysol was good enough and wear a mask. Our nation needs a huge wake up call when it comes to our education and I am so happy Mrs. Morris spoke out about it.
